A new addition to the popular series written by the adopted grandson of Rose Wilder, Laura Ingalls Wilder's daughter. The Wilder family struggles to make a success of Rocky Ridge, their little farm in the Ozarks. Young Rose must help her parents as they battle the natural disasters of a cyclone, a drought, and a forest fire. But there are good times as well, when Rose attends her first party in town.
